I have an initial array of object which is my data. A function called render()
is called which should first display rectangles bound to this data. But I am not seeing any rectangles.
Then if any of these rectangles is clicked a function removeElement
is called, which removes that rectangle's data from the array and then calls render()
and executes it using the new data.
If the svg is clicked on anywhere a new data element is added to the data, and again render is called which should display the rectangles again according to the new data.

If you look at group
...
var group = svg.selectAll(null)
.data(data, function(d) {
return d.x
});
... you'll see that it is just an "update" selection. There is no SVG <g>
element being appended here. Thus, this...
group.append("rect")
//etc...
Has no effect.
Solution: Use a merge()
function or a proper enter selection:
var groupEnter = group.enter()
.append("g")
.attr("class", "group");
groupEnter.append("rect")
//etc...
